Solar Batteries Stonelands, QLD 4612
The 4612 postcode, which includes Stonelands, Hivesville, Kawl Kawl, Keysland and Wigton, has 129 households. Of these, 66 homes — or 51.2% — have installed rooftop solar panels, reflecting the community's growing move toward renewable energy. With more Stonelands residents looking to reduce their reliance on the electricity grid, many are now turning to solar battery storage as the next step. Solar batteries help homeowners lower energy bills, increase energy independence, and improve long-term sustainability.
According to daily average sunshine data from the nearest weather station at Proston Post Office, households in this community receive approximately 5.4 kWh of sunlight per day. Across 4612, rooftop solar systems collectively generate approximately 517,000 kWh of clean energy each year, based on an average system size of 4.7 kW. At current electricity rates, that's equivalent to around $155,100 of clean energy at grid electricity costs annually.

While there haven’t been any official battery system installations recorded locally yet, the area already boasts 66 solar installations with a combined capacity of 308 kW—a strong foundation for battery storage. For residents considering the move, battery system sizes typically range from 6.75 kWh to well over 13.5 kWh, with trusted brands such as Tesla, BYD, and Sonnen available for homes and businesses alike. When you install solar batteries, you can expect average annual bill savings around these ranges:
- 6–8 kWh system: $900–$1,300
- 10–13 kWh system: $1,400–$2,000
- 14 kWh+: $2,100–$2,800 Of course, the exact savings depend on your household usage, but the return is significant for most Stonelands properties, especially for those owned outright or with manageable mortgages.

Interest in battery storage, solar batteries rebate, and Virtual Power Plants (VPPs) is ramping up across Stonelands and Queensland. The Australian Federal Government’s solar batteries rebate QLD program makes it easier than ever to get started, offering discounts of up to 30% off battery costs. For a typical 11.5–13.5 kWh battery, that’s a saving of around $3,400–$4,000 on installation, which can halve payback periods to just 3–4 years. VPP participation can further boost your system’s value by letting you share stored power and earn rewards, while increasing your property’s resilience to grid outages.
